Writing an informal letter

Slide 34 - Diapositive

Informal letter
Trompetstraat 1
3822 CK Amersfoort
The Netherlands
-
9 February 2022
-
Dear John, 
-
First paragraph: refer to previous letter, or ask about somebody's health, introduce topic you want to talk about.
-
Second paragraph: elaborate on topic, give examples (You might use a third paragraph if you have to write a lot of information. 
-
Third (or fourth) paragraph: ask for their opinion, use a closing line and mention that you hope to hear from them soon 
-
Love/ kind regards/best wishes,

-
Afsluitende groet,
(Voornaam)
